Abstract

Bei bekannten Überlastsicherungen für Kreisel­ pumpen wer den zur Messung der Temperatur Tempe­ raturmeßfühler eingesetzt, die direkt in das von der Pumpe geförderte Flüssigkeitsmedium eintauchen. Bei einer Abweichung der von den Temperaturmeßfühlern gemessenen Temperatur von einem vorgegebenen Temperatur-Soll-Wert wird über eine Verstelleinrichtung ein Auslaßventil geöffnet und/oder ein akustisches oder opti­ sches Signal ausgelöst oder der Pumpenantrieb abgeschaltet. Hierbei besteht insbesondere bei der Förderung von Flüssigkeiten mit chemisch aggressiven Stoffen und/oder abrasiven Fest­ stoffen die Gefahr daß die Temperaturmeßfühler sehr rasch zerstört werden und dadurch als Meß­ organe zur Erfassung der Betriebstemperatur ausfallen. Auch sind diese Überlastsicherungen im konstruktiven Aufbau verhältnismäßig kompli­ ziert. Erfindungsgemäß wird demgegenüber eine im konstruktiven Aufbau besonders einfache und stets funktionsfähige Überlastsicherung für Kreiselpumpen dadurch erreicht daß das Auslaß­ ventil (11) und die Temperaturmeßfühler (2, 3) in der Wandung (1) des Spiralgehäuses angeord­ net sind, wobei die Temperaturmeßfühler (2, 3) im Körper der Wandung (1) des Spiralgehäuses, und zwar mit Abstand (d) von der inneren Wand­ fläche (18) angeordnet sind.
